Abstract

The development of information technology has made various aspects of life easier, including product marketing through marketplace applications. In Pasar Bengkel Village, known as a culinary center, vendors have experienced a decline in the number of customers due to the operation of the Medan–Tebing Tinggi toll road, which has reduced visitor traffic. The purpose of this study is to design a marketplace application with a recommendation system that can help vendors increase product visibility and attract customers back. The research method is the application of a Content-Based Filtering-based recommendation system with the Term Frequency–Inverse Document Frequency (TF-IDF) algorithm to process product description data and generate relevant recommendations for users. The result of this study is a marketplace application that is able to provide personalized product recommendations based on the frequency of word occurrences in product descriptions using the TF-IDF technique. In conclusion, this application is expected to be an innovative solution in increasing the competitiveness of local culinary vendors by expanding their marketing reach and maintaining the sustainability of their businesses..

Abstract

Ainun Bag Store is a fashion retail business specializing in the sale of high-quality women’s bags, both locally made and imported, at affordable prices. However, the store still relies on manual systems for managing operations, marketing, transactions, and inventory. Customers are required to visit the store directly to make purchases, and all transaction records are manually written in physical ledgers. This conventional method has several limitations, such as inefficient inventory management, potential human error, and a lack of accessible sales data. Additionally, consumer behavior—such as satisfaction with service—has a direct impact on sales performance. This study aims to design and develop a web-based e-commerce platform for Ainun Bag Store by applying the Economic Order Quantity (EOQ) method and Consumer Behavior Analysis. The EOQ method is implemented to optimize stock levels and reduce storage costs, while Consumer Behavior Analysis is used to understand customer preferences and improve overall satisfaction.

Abstract

The productivity of red chili cultivation highly depends on the quality of seeds used by farmers. However, identifying superior red chili seeds is often difficult, leading to low yields and even crop failure. This study aims to design a Decision Support System (DSS) for selecting superior red chili seeds using the SMARTER (Simple Multi Attribute Rating Technique Exploiting Rank) and TOPSIS (Technique for Order Preference by Similarity to Ideal Solution) methods. The SMARTER method is applied to determine the weight of each criterion based on the Rank Order Centroid (ROC), while the TOPSIS method is used to rank alternative seed varieties. Seven criteria were considered: price, disease resistance, harvest time, fruit length, fruit weight, number of branches, and yield potential. The system was developed using a waterfall model and implemented in a web-based application with PHP and MySQL. The results showed that the best-ranked alternative was the Tangguh F1 variety with a preference value of 0.7429, followed by Kastilo and TM999. The developed DSS provides structured, efficient, and transparent recommendations, thus helping farmers and agricultural agencies in decision-making for selecting superior red chili seeds.
